Why you should buy the Samsung The Frame TV

Samsung is one of thebest TV brandswith a wide range of options, including the inventive Samsung The Frame TV. It features an anti-reflection display with a premium matte film for a canvas-like finish, for the purpose of showing artwork when the TV’s not in use. With Art Mode activated, the Samsung The Frame TV will display paintings that you can download from the Samsung Art Store or your personal photos. The TV will only show artwork when someone is in the room, which it can determine using its motion sensor, and you can customize its bezel to your preferred design.

The Samsung The Frame TV is also aQLED TVthat uses quantum dot technology to display accurate colors and incredible brightness, and it’s powered by Samsung’s Quantum Processor 4K to enable4K Ultra HDquality and immersive audio output. The TV runs on the Tizen operating system for access to all of the popularstreaming services, and it works with theSmartThingsplatform for easy integration into your smart home ecosystem.
